F4W said:
There are currently no plans for WWE to bring RAW back to two hours each week. WWE officials like the extra money they're making each week and they are looking at more hours of TV and more rights fees each week. That's where WWE is focused on growing their business right now - not live events or pay-per-views but TV and rights fees.


Not huge news but thought it was worth a mention. RAW has been a three hour show since the 23rd of July 2012 which was the 1000th episode of RAW so it is closing in on one year with the new format.

When it was initially launched I had hoped that with the extra hour that WWE would spend more time promoting the midcard divisions to strengthen the show from top to bottom. That hasn't happened as the main focus has still been on the maineventers and for the most part the midcarders are an after thought.

Do you still enjoy RAW three hours each week or would you like to see WWE drop back to two?
